Leadership Overview
TKC HOLDINGS has 6 executives leading key functions including corporate strategy, technology infrastructure, information systems, legal compliance, human capital management, and operational oversight.
Focused on delivering essential services to the corrections and hospitality sectors, TKC HOLDINGS maintains a commitment to operational excellence and market-leading supply chain solutions across North America.
